Output 50c05e36d6fd6a53d06c5365b438f54d277b0c30da532a5a53edc3c89743927e:0

value
1000894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823656ab420e117f87a784f530b4de023c3e989a OP_EQUAL
address
3DZWrzPxUDiMVc2q5N6mZP8PmMFm2aDvu5
transaction
50c05e36d6fd6a53d06c5365b438f54d277b0c30da532a5a53edc3c89743927e
spent
true